Date | Name | Activity | Value |
|---|---|---|---|
Jan 13, 2026 | xxxxxxxxxxxxx | $1993233 | |
Dec 19, 2025 | xxxxxxxxxxxxx | $1763532 | |
May 14, 2025 | xxxxxxxxxxxxx | $85222 | |
Mar 07, 2025 | xxxxxxxxxxxxx | $744519 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$3256410 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$11546976 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$22372903 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$26133621 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 17,681,129 | Insider | 8.30% | 112,098,358 | |
| 7,317,606 | Institution | 3.07% | 46,393,622 | |
| 7,062,279 | Institution | 2.96% | 44,774,849 | |
| 5,123,443 | Institution | 2.15% | 32,482,629 | |
| 3,365,836 | Institution | 1.41% | 21,339,400 | |
| 2,982,847 | Institution | 1.25% | 18,911,250 | |
| 2,765,100 | Institution | 1.16% | 17,530,734 | |
| 2,630,013 | Institution | 1.10% | 16,674,282 | |
| 2,592,088 | Institution | 1.09% | 16,433,838 | |
| 2,521,451 | Institution | 1.06% | 15,985,999 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 7,062,279 | Institution | 2.96% | 44,774,849 | |
| 3,365,836 | Institution | 1.41% | 21,339,400 | |
| 2,982,847 | Institution | 1.25% | 18,911,250 | |
| 2,765,100 | Institution | 1.16% | 17,530,734 | |
| 2,630,013 | Institution | 1.10% | 16,674,282 | |
| 2,521,451 | Institution | 1.06% | 15,985,999 | |
| 2,470,000 | Institution | 1.03% | 15,659,800 | |
| 2,353,783 | Institution | 0.99% | 14,922,984 | |
| 1,932,167 | Institution | 0.81% | 12,249,939 | |
| 1,754,953 | Institution | 0.74% | 11,126,402 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 5,416,265 | Institution | 2.27% | 33,310,030 | |
| 2,187,134 | Institution | 0.92% | 13,450,874 | |
| 1,837,555 | Institution | 0.77% | 11,300,963 | |
| 1,548,863 | Institution | 0.65% | 9,525,507 | |
| 1,075,459 | Institution | 0.45% | 11,851,558 | |
| 219,887 | Institution | 0.09% | 1,376,493 | |
| 192,876 | Institution | 0.08% | 2,125,494 | |
| 114,107 | Institution | 0.05% | 701,758 | |
| 101,061 | Institution | 0.04% | 621,525 | |
| 99,389 | Institution | 0.04% | 611,242 |